We are seeking a Senior Mechanical Engineer with strong technical expertise and experience in proposal and business development. This role is ideal for a seasoned professional who can lead complex hydropower and dam projects, mentor teams, and actively contribute to client engagement.
In the Niagara Falls office you will have the opportunity to be involved in some of the most exciting hydropower and dam projects worldwide. As a successful candidate, you will:
-
1. Technical Design & Analysis
-
Perform system analyses, establish user requirements, analyze system functional and performance requirements, define design criteria, and provide input to the design team on layouts and designs
-
Lead and execute mechanical engineering design and analysis for hydropower and dam projects
-
Developing preliminary and detailed designs as well as overseeing and guiding the preparation of mechanical drawings and engineering specifications for construction
-
Prepare technical specifications based on input received from other disciplines
-
Prepare, review or approve technical deliverables such as equipment designs, specifications, data sheets, calculations, etc.
-
Prepare and contribute to technical memos and reports, within your areas of expertise
-
Provide input to engineering, operating and capital cost estimates
-
Prepare, review or approve project standard specifications and design criteria
-
Provide input to 3D models and 2D mechanical drawings
-
Participate in and contribute to design reviews
-
Assist in the commissioning of systems on site as required
-
Follow company standard quality procedures
2. Project Management & Leadership
-
Leading and managing the process of engineering commitments in accordance with scope, schedule, budget and procedures to ensure successful project completion
-
Take ownership of high-level technical deliverables and ensure quality standards
-
Manage and review engineering work packages associated with project deliverables including management of project budgets and schedule
-
Providing mentoring, coaching, technical guidance and quality assurance to other engineers in order to ensure the technical adequacy of engineering work
3. Business Development & Client Engagement
-
Prepare and review proposals, including scope, schedule, and budget development
-
Collaborate with business development teams to identify opportunities and build client relationships
-
Participate in client meetings, presentations, and negotiations.
-
You bring to the role:
Education & Credentials
-
A Bachelor’s degree in mechanical engineering
-
A Master’s degree in Mechanical Engineering would be considered an asset
-
Registration as a Professional Engineer in Ontario or other Canadian Province (candidates with strong international experience and eligibility for P Eng. designation in Canada will be considered)
Experience & Technical Expertise
-
A minimum of 15 years of professional experience, preferably in hydropower projects and hydromechanical equipment (e.g., dams, gates, penstocks, etc.). Experience with turbines and rotating equipment is considered an asset.
-
Proficiency with Computer Design Tools (Mathcad, AutoCAD, Inventor, Solidworks) will be considered an asset
-
Experience with Finite Element Analysis (FEA) programs
-
Knowledge of Canadian and provincial codes and standards
Leadership & Management
-
Manage multidisciplinary project teams and ensure successful delivery within budget and timelines
-
Experience in leading small and large mechanical teams in multi-disciplinary projects
-
Ability to delegate tasks and effectively supervise engineers and designers
Soft Skills & Attributes
-
Strong client focus and a desire to achieve results including the ability to manage multiple priorities and timelines
-
Excellent communication and interpersonal skills
-
Good planning and organizational skills
-
Ability to function with minimal supervision
